CBB: Many of our readers appreciated your honesty about the initial ambivalence you felt towards pregnancy, and you’ve continued to be open – for example, speaking out about your postpartum figure being airbrushed away on a magazine cover. Why is it important to you to speak your mind about issues others may consider too personal?
Kourtney: I feel that if I’m going through something, I’m sure someone else is too. I try to be as honest with myself and others as I can be. If my situation can help anyone else, that’s even more of a reason.
A large percentage of CBB commenters think baby Mason looks just like your brother Rob! Whose features do you see in him?
So many people say he looks just like Rob and my Dad! I think he takes after my side of the family, but he definitely has Scott’s exact chin and ears. He looks like Mason to me. I stare at him all day.
Is Mason hitting any milestones yet?
Yes! He’s smiling all the time … it’s one of my favorite things. He rolled over at two weeks!
Can you walk us through your daily routine now that you have a baby? Do you have a nanny or family help?
Every day is different. I always wake up before him, get breakfast started, get his outfit laid out, bath ready. We always have playtime, storytime and bathtime every day.
I don’t have a nanny at this time … I bring Mason with me everywhere. I made a decision to really spend as much time with him as possible. Not make lots of plans … just focus on Mason. The couple of times he hasn’t been with Scott or me, he’s with my mom or sisters.
For many moms, nursing can be both a frustrating and rewarding experience. How has it been for you?
Breastfeeding has been going very well! I love and appreciate the bonding time with Mason. Nursing is surprisingly one of my favorite things.
